- Biggleswade_Rugby_Club abstract "Biggleswade Rugby Club is a Rugby club based in Biggleswade, England. The club was founded in 1949 and is affiliated to the RFU and East Midlands Rugby Union.Youth teams play in the Saracens Herts & Middlesex Leagues and the club is an official partner club of Saracens. The Mini section, known as 'Biggy Minis' celebrate their 40th Year in 2015 and have teams from U6 through to U12 while the Youth section runs teams from U13s, U15s to U18s.The Club colours are Blue with a Red band. The club runs up to four senior sides including Vets, with Mini, and Youth sides.A storming season in 2013/14 saw them promoted as league champions back to Midlands 2 East (South)with just 2 losses all season! The 2014/15 season saw the First XV occupy third slot in the league for much of the season, just missing out on promotion.The 'Biggleswade Development' team won the Greene King Premiere Cup in April 2013 and joined the Herts and Middlesex Merit Table 4 for the 2013-2014 season gaining promotion and also lifting the H & M Knockout Cup at their first attempt. The Third XV also competed in the Herts and Middlesex Merit Table 7 for the 2013/14 season finishing 3rd in the table.Probably the first golden age for the club was in the late 1980s when, along with other accolades were winners of East Midlands One, then in 1989/90 winners of the East Midlands/Leicester League and the Beds County Cup 1991 and finalists in the East Midlands cup 1991. The First XV was then a young team bolstered by a number of former top flight players who turned out for Biggy.For the 2015/15 season the club will have new faces throughout with Dom Nott taking over as Club Captain and Liam Price captaining the Development/Second XV while Dave Tyson continues as Third XV captainThe new club chairman if former referee Pete Biernis while John Thoday takes over as Club President.The clubhouse has a bar, lounge and four squash courts, the club have six full pitches plus Minis pitches and big training area. The club owned their facilities and 3 pitches (clubhouse side) outright and rent a parcel of land known as Sheepwalk where there are 3 further full size pitches. All facilities are available for hire .Youth players from the club are currently at Elite player development centres with Northampton Saints and Saracens with former Youth players in the RFU Championship with Charlie Beech at Yorkshire Carnegie and Glyn Hughes at Moseley.The club were awarded a £38K Sport England Inspired Facilities grant in 2014 which has been used to totally refurbish the Lounge Bar adding new flooring, furnishings, TVs, bar area and the gents rugby toilets. This is the first phase of a programme to upgrade the club facilities.In September 2008 the club won the England Rugby / O2 Community Connections Competition for its work for the local community, giving twenty players from the club the chance to train with the England squad.".
